Understanding the Contemporary Challenges in Marine Biodiversity Preservation

Marine environments are experiencing significant stressors that threaten the delicate balance of life below water. According to the United Nations Environment Programme (UNEP), over 30% of global fish stocks are overexploited, and more than 80% of the world’s wastewater, including agricultural runoff and industrial effluents, flows into oceans without adequate treatment. These pressing issues necessitate a strategic shift—moving from reactive measures to proactive, scientifically-informed conservation planning.

Core Principles of Modern Marine Conservation Strategies

The foundation of effective marine conservation rests on four interconnected pillars:

  2. Community Engagement and Education: Empowering local communities to participate in conservation efforts ensures sustainable outcomes. Highlighting success stories and providing educational tools are central to this pillar.
  3. Policy and Governance Innovation: Developing adaptive management frameworks that can respond to evolving environmental challenges while ensuring compliance with international agreements like the Convention on Biological Diversity (CBD).
  4. Monitoring and Adaptive Management: Establishing continuous assessment protocols, leveraging technology such as satellite tracking, and refining strategies accordingly.
